Boullier: Magnussen will have successful career

– McLaren Racing Director Eric Boullier says that test and reserve driver Kevin Magnussen will have a successful career, following the team's decision to release him at the end of the year.Magnussen joined McLaren's young driver scheme in 2010 and graduated to a race seat in 2014, before being demoted to a test and reserve role this season.McLaren informed Magnussen via email on his birthday that his services would not be required next year, though Boullier clarified that the Dane had not been sacked and that he should enjoy a long career in the sport."First of all, he has not been fired," Boullier said when asked if the manner of Magnussen's exit was unfair."I want to...
